You could try decompiling the framework-res.apk and then modifying the file "storage_list.xml" in "res/xml/" and add the proper values, something like:
"<storage
android:mountPoint="/storage/sdcard1"
android:storageDescription="@string/storage_sd_card"
android:removable="true"
android:maxFileSize="4096" />"
(from https://source.android.com/devices/tech/storage/config-example.html)
after the existing entry in there.
Then you would need to recompile the .apk and add that to the device.
After that, it might show up (with the right Kernel).

The first full boot of our ROM was at 24/06/2013, current explaination of what works / does not
WiFi Tethering and WiFi Direct:
Wi-Fi Direct will probably NEVER work, we are working on Wi-Fi Tethering, which is probably going to work.
OMX -> Hardware Decoders / Encoders.
ST-Ericsson fault for NOT giving sources, it will NEVER work without them.
Camera
It's just missing symbols, it WILL work
Torch
Needs configuration, it WILL work
Audio
ST-Ericsson NEVER gave the sources, it's KIND of working, BUT is probable it never work at it's FULLEST
Bluetooth
Needs vendor configuration, it WILL work
_______________________________________________________________
Installation things for the paranoic ones:
YOU MUST INSTALL boot.img VIA FASTBOOT/FLASHTOOL IF GIVES YOU ERRORS
So, someone surely will see...set perms failed, this is because we must add a custom edifier/ota tools packager script written in Python 2.x
IF you see the some set_perms failed. IT doesn't mean that the ROM failed to install, just SOME of the files permission weren't applied because mostly THEY DON'T EXIST.
What to do? stay at recovery, go to advanced settings and select "fix permissions". THIS is not required, if you find any problems, just try, it will not do harm to your phone.

Please people, just DON'T go ahead and flash WITHOUT READING THE FIRST THREE POSTS
No internal storage means...screenshots can't be saved, want to take a screenshot?
You need adb on linux, or adb and ffmpeg on Windows.
adb pull /dev/graphics/fb0 fb0
ffmpeg -vframes 1 -vcodec rawvideo -f rawvideo -pix_fmt rgb32 -s 480x854 -i fb0 -f image2 -vcodec png image.png

No, bluetooth doesn't work, yet.
Why? well, we need to FIND the actual bluetooth UART Port, once that's is found (it's somewhere in init the files), we just need to add it in the bluetooth configuration files (they are the same in S Advance), compile, and done

Before you install CM-11.0: Preparation (First three are optional. If you want to start fresh, these can be skipped)
Install AppBak from Market, run it and save a list of all your apps.
Install SMS Backup and Restore from Market, run it and backup your SMS history.
Install Call Logs Backup and Restore from Market, run it and backup your call log history.
Boot into ClockworkMod recovery. Make a full backup. You will need this backup later if you decide to go back to your previous ROM and data.
WARNING: Many apps will Force Close crash if you restore data from a previous ROM.
Install ClockworkMod Recovery
Warning: Only use this recovery to flash CM-11.0. Otherwise, you risk bricking your phone!2
Wipe data and cache.
Flash cm-11*.zip.
Flash gapps*.zip. You must flash gapps after every upgrade to CM11.0 since /system is formatted, wiping your previous add-ons.
Reboot phone.
After you setup your Google account, reinstall the three apps from Market in order to restore most of your apps, call log and SMS history.
Warning: Do not restore backup data of system apps!
If you restore a bad backup with cached settings in telephony.db in data/data/com.*.*.telephony it can break MMS.
It seems that restoring backups can also break Calendar sync.
Upgrades
Upgrades from previous versions of CM11.0 are the same process as install, except you do not need to wipe anything. Contrary to popular belief, you do not need to even wipe cache and dalvik-cache when upgrading between CM11.0 versions. You only need to wipe if you are doing a major upgrade, switching to a different ROM entirely, or attempting to fix bugs caused by bad backups or corrupt app data.

D802 @ AOSPA 4.6b3
Here's what made the issue go away for me on D802. This might be dangerous, so don't do it if you can't live with the risk of bricking your phone, you are entirely on your own if something goes wrong.
Prerequesites:
- Install official 4.6b3 AOSPA-legacy zip-image to phone
- [optional] Install Renders Kernel
- Install updated root
- Download and extract unofficial 4.6b3 VS980 zip-image from @777jon 's thread (yeah, it's the wrong phone, but we need only one file; find thread in Forum yourself, got yelled at for crosslinking stuff before )
Procedure:
-MAKE NANDROID BACKUP!
-Copy file from extracted VS980-image [zip]/system/lib/hw/hwcomposer.msm8974.so to phone's sdcard folder via USB (eg. ./Download)
-Start terminal on phone or adb shell
-Create backup dir:
Code:
mkdir /sdcard/noheatbackup
-get root access by typing
Code:
su
-make /system writeable by typing
Code:
mount -o remount,rw /system
-backup existing file by typing
Code:
cp /system/lib/hw/hwcomposer.msm8974.so /sdcard/noheatbackup/
-overwrite existing file by typing
Code:
cp /sdcard/Download/hwcomposer.msm8974.so /system/lib/hw/
-reboot by typing
Code:
reboot
-Note that you will need to be on a root shell to remove the backup again with
Code:
rm -r /sdcard/noheatbackup
:
Screenshot after replacing /system/lib/hw/hwcomposer.msm8974.so : Heat issue gone, see temp in status bar. After deep sleep, temps are about 3-5 K over room temperature.
